Carey Mulligan is set to star in war correspondent movie On the Other Side

June 2, 2017 by Samuel Brace

Carey Mulligan is attached to star in a war correspondent film titled On the Other Side. The newly rebranded studio First Look Media is co-producing the project, with the movie telling the true story of Kate Webb, a war correspondent held captive during the Vietnam War.
